Expanding Applications Fueling Growth in PCR Amplification Technologies

PCR amplification remains at the center of breakthroughs across modern life sciences, supporting advancements in genetic engineering, clinical diagnostics, and pharmaceutical innovation. Laboratories around the world rely on PCR systems for tasks ranging from basic DNA replication to highly specialized molecular assays. As scientific demand evolves, equipment manufacturers focus on developing systems with enhanced precision, improved thermal cycling performance, and greater automation to meet the needs of complex workflows. These advancements drive competition and differentiate companies seeking to expand their presence within the global marketplace.

One of the strongest competitive drivers is the rising demand for real-time PCR equipment within clinical diagnostics. Hospitals and laboratories use these systems to detect infectious diseases, analyze genetic mutations, and validate therapeutic responses. Manufacturers that deliver faster processing speeds, improved sample throughput, and enhanced sensitivity gain significant advantages in clinical market segments. Additionally, digital PCR technologies are gaining traction due to their superior accuracy in quantifying DNA and RNA, positioning companies in this niche for rapid market share gains.

The research sector also plays a central role in shaping competitive outcomes. Academic institutions, biotech companies, and pharmaceutical manufacturers require flexible amplification tools capable of supporting diverse research applications. Vendors offering adaptable and modular systems can capture broader market segments, especially those involved in drug discovery, gene expression analysis, and biological assay development. Ongoing collaborations between equipment manufacturers and research institutes help strengthen product innovation pipelines while increasing brand visibility in the scientific community.

Regional competitiveness varies based on technological maturity, availability of research funding, and diagnostic demand. North America remains a dominant force due to its strong biotechnology ecosystem, while Europe maintains steady growth driven by investments in genomic medicine. Asia-Pacific markets, particularly China, Japan, and South Korea, demonstrate robust expansion fueled by rapidly growing R&D infrastructures and active government support for advanced laboratory technologies.
